About Discovery Golf
Discovery Golf is a new international venture from Discovery that brings coverage from the best professional golf events, equipment, and instruction to fans around the world. Discovery Golf has recently acquired Golf Digest and is further expanding the already amazing Golf Digest content with new digital products.
The Role
The Discovery Golf Product Team is looking for a Web Product Manager to support the business with managing the development and execution of the digital products and platforms for Golf Digest. Specifically, this Product Manager will be focused on operating and replatforming Golf Digest’s web products.
You will be responsible for carrying features through the full product lifecycle – ideation to production, supplementing with product requirement documents, market research, user stories, user testing, defining KPIs, wireframes, flow diagrams, testing, risk analysis and other supporting information to make product iterations successful. You will be at the intersection between the business, customers and technology.
